Dismissed

The Board dismissed the RAMP appeal for entitlement to an effective date prior to September 1, 2018, for the addition of the Veteran's spouse to his compensation award as it does not have jurisdiction over this matter.

The deciding factor: The Board did not have jurisdiction to address the Veteran’s claim under the Rapid Appeals Modernization Program (RAMP appeal).

What this means for you

A dismissal means the Board did not decide the issue on its merits — usually because it was withdrawn or had become moot. It says more about procedure than about whether a claim like this can win.
